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Sea Temperature in the Atlantic Ocean in Punta Negra: General Trends and Swimming Opportunities
The climate in the coastal area of the Maldonado Department, Uruguay, is generally characterized as humid subtropical, with warm, wet summers and mild, relatively dry winters. The region enjoys a comfortable, temperate climate with an annual average temperature of around 17°C (62°F).
Punta Negra is located in South America in the Southern Hemisphere at a latitude of -35 degrees, along the shores of the Atlantic Ocean. Punta Negra lies within the Maldonado Department in Uruguay.
The average annual daytime air temperature in Punta Negra is 20°C (68°F), with the average nighttime temperature being 12°C (54°F). The highest average daily temperature occurs in January, reaching 27°C (81°F), while the lowest is in July at 14°C (58°F). As for nighttime temperatures, the minimum average temperature of 7°C (45°F) is recorded in July, and the maximum is in January, reaching 18°C (64°F).
According to historical data, Punta Negra experiences 98 rainy days per year, which accounts for 27 percent of all days in the year. On average, there are 8 rainy days each month. The wettest month is February, with 10 rainy days and 89 mm (3.5 inches) of precipitation, while the driest month is August, which typically has 8 rainy days and only 90 mm (3.5 inches) of precipitation.
The average annual water temperature in Atlantic Ocean in Punta Negra is 18°C (64°F). In July, the water reaches its lowest point of the year at 9°C (48°F), while in January, it peaks at 26°C (79°F).
